Mobile Solutions for Scrap Metal Recycling Efficiency
A privately held, Detroit-based company operates across various industries including metals recycling, real estate, industrial services, beverage distribution, automotive retailing, transportation, hydroponic greenhouse operations, and logistics.
Scope of Work:
The engagement required transitioning the organization from its manual, paper-driven processes to a fully automated, enterprise-ready solution accessible across all customer locations. The system needed the capability to capture pictures and videos of scrap materials onsite and transmit them in real time to administrative offices, ensuring immediate visibility and decision support. Additionally, the solution had to consolidate, catalog, and securely store all captured media for future reference and audit needs.
The architecture was also designed with an AI-Enabled architecture, enabling future enhancements such as automated scrap classification, quality scoring, and intelligent anomaly detection to further strengthen operational accuracy and decision-making.
Business Challenge:
-
Manual Workflow Bottlenecks
The organization relied on fully manual processes to manage scrap-metal operations, creating significant operational strain on both Sales and IT teams responsible for execution and oversight. -
On-Site Data Collection Overload
Teams were required to physically visit customer locations, capture scrap-metal details, and manually relay this information to administrative centers, resulting in fragmented data capture and slow turnaround. -
Geographically Distributed Operations
Scrap yards and customer sites were dispersed across multiple regions, making coordination, data consolidation, and timely communication increasingly time-consuming and inefficient. -
Unstructured Bidding Inputs
Bid-related data was not centrally consolidated or preserved, leading to inconsistent decision-making, lack of historical reference, and an inability to maintain traceable bid archives.
JRD Systems Solutions:
- Workflow Clarity: Analyzed the existing application to build the complete As-Is process flow.
- Future-State Alignment: Mapped requirements and process steps to define the To-Be model.
- Mobile Innovation: Proposed a new mobile app integrated seamlessly with SharePoint 2010.
- Unified Data Exchange: Enabled mobile-to-SharePoint communication via a custom JRDSI web service.
- Centralized Media Archiving: Stored all uploaded media files in a SharePoint 2010 document library for long-term reference.
- AI-Enabled Architecture: Designed the solution to support future automated tagging and image classification.
- Intelligent Distribution: Allowed configuration of email recipients for automated media file sharing.
- Custom Solution Rollout: Delivered and deployed a tailored solution to end users.
- Enterprise Tech Foundation: Built on .NET, Oracle, HTML, JavaScript, and IIS technologies.
